Android 安卓发布谷歌地图

Android 安卓发布谷歌地图,android,google-maps,android-intent,Android,Google Maps,Android Intent,如何启动google maps transit get directions,以便在通过坐标或地名输入来源和目的地时,google maps建议公交(公交路线)方向。这是一个骑自行车的代码,但我在developers.google.com(启动谷歌地图)上找不到一个 发生这种情况是因为您的请求的模式值为“b” mode=b 由于模式传递的文档中没有传输的价值,SO社区提出了这个问题。开发人员遇到了各种解决方法来处理这种情况 以下是一些: 希望这有帮助 没有文档记录,但“r”是公共的Tran

如何启动google maps transit get directions,以便在通过坐标或地名输入来源和目的地时,google maps建议公交(公交路线)方向。这是一个骑自行车的代码,但我在developers.google.com(启动谷歌地图)上找不到一个


发生这种情况是因为您的请求的模式值为“b”

mode=b
由于模式传递的文档中没有传输的价值,SO社区提出了这个问题。开发人员遇到了各种解决方法来处理这种情况

以下是一些:


希望这有帮助

没有文档记录,但“r”是公共的Transit

Uri gmmIntentUri = Uri.parse("google.navigation:q=Taronga+Zoo,+Sydney+Australia&mode=r");
Intent mapIntent = new Intent(Intent.ACTION_VIEW, gmmIntentUri);
mapIntent.setPackage("com.google.android.apps.maps");
startActivity(mapIntent);
Uri gmmIntentUri = Uri.parse("google.navigation:q=Taronga+Zoo,+Sydney+Australia&mode=r");
Intent mapIntent = new Intent(Intent.ACTION_VIEW, gmmIntentUri);
mapIntent.setPackage("com.google.android.apps.maps");
startActivity(mapIntent);